给我一个测试用例的模板
时间: 2023-11-24 22:08:27 浏览: 45
这是一个测试用例的模板:
测试用例编号:TC001
测试用例名称:测试登录功能
测试步骤:
1. 打开登录页面
2. 输入正确的用户名和密码
3. 点击登录按钮
4. 验证是否成功登录
预期结果:
成功登录后跳转到首页,并显示用户的用户名。
实际结果:
成功登录后跳转到首页,并显示用户的用户名。
测试结论:
该登录功能通过测试。
备注:
在测试过程中,需要注意输入的用户名和密码是否正确,以及登录后是否跳转到了正确的页面。同时,还需要测试登录失败的情况,例如输入错误的密码或用户名不存在。
相关问题
给我一个界面测试的测试用例模板
好的,以下是一个界面测试的测试用例模板:
**测试用例编号:**
**测试项目:**
**测试目的:**
**前置条件:**
**测试步骤:**
1.
2.
3.
**预期结果:**
1.
2.
3.
**实际结果:**
1.
2.
3.
**测试结论:**
**测试人员:**
**日期:**
请根据具体的测试项目和测试目的进行填写,测试用例要尽可能详细地描述测试步骤和预期结果,以便测试人员能够准确执行测试,发现并报告问题。同时,测试用例也要包括实际结果和测试结论,以便测试人员对测试结果进行评估和反馈。
编写一个单元测试用例模板
好的,以下是一个基本的单元测试用例模板:
```python
import unittest
class TestMyCode(unittest.TestCase):
def setUp(self):
# 在每个测试用例之前执行的代码
pass
def tearDown(self):
# 在每个测试用例之后执行的代码
pass
def test_case_1(self):
# 测试用例1
# 断言语句
self.assertEqual(1+1, 2)
def test_case_2(self):
# 测试用例2
# 断言语句
self.assertTrue(True)
def test_case_3(self):
# 测试用例3
# 断言语句
self.assertIn('a', ['a', 'b', 'c'])
if __name__ == '__main__':
unittest.main()
```
这个模板包括了三个测试用例,每个测试用例都有一个断言语句来验证代码是否按照预期运行。setUp()和tearDown()方法可以在每个测试用例前后执行一些代码,例如初始化数据或清理数据等。最后使用unittest.main()方法来运行测试用例。